Cross-linkers Market in Russia: An Overview

Cross-linkers are essential chemical compounds used to enhance the performance and durability of materials by forming covalent or ionic bonds between polymer chains. These compounds play a crucial role in industries such as coatings, adhesives, rubber, and healthcare, providing improved mechanical strength, thermal stability, and chemical resistance. In Russia, the cross-linkers market is gaining momentum due to growing demand in construction, automotive, and industrial applications. Key Drivers and Challenges in the Market

Drivers:

  1. Construction Sector Growth: Cross-linkers are extensively used in coatings and sealants for enhanced durability and weather resistance in construction projects.
  2. Automotive Industry Expansion: The demand for lightweight and high-strength materials in automotive applications supports the use of cross-linkers.
  3. Industrial Applications: Cross-linkers improve the performance of adhesives, elastomers, and composites, driving their adoption in manufacturing processes.
  4. Healthcare Innovations: The use of biocompatible cross-linkers in medical devices and drug delivery systems is fueling growth in the healthcare sector.

Challenges:

  1. High Production Costs: The cost of producing advanced cross-linkers can limit their adoption in price-sensitive industries.
  2. Environmental Concerns: The use of certain cross-linking agents poses ecological risks, necessitating the development of sustainable alternatives.
  3. Raw Material Volatility: Fluctuations in the availability and pricing of raw materials used in cross-linker production can impact market dynamics.

Market Segmentation and Key Applications

The Russia cross-linkers market can be segmented based on type, application, and end-user industry:

By Type:

  • Aromatic Cross-Linkers: Used for high-performance applications requiring chemical and thermal stability.
  • Aliphatic Cross-Linkers: Preferred in coatings and adhesives for their versatility and UV resistance.
  • Silane-Based Cross-Linkers: Widely used in construction and automotive applications for adhesion promotion.
  • Epoxy-Based Cross-Linkers: Popular in industrial and specialty coatings.

By Application:

  • Coatings: Enhances durability, adhesion, and chemical resistance in industrial, automotive, and decorative coatings.
  • Adhesives and Sealants: Improves bonding strength and flexibility in construction and packaging applications.
  • Rubber and Elastomers: Provides enhanced mechanical properties for tires, seals, and gaskets.
  • Healthcare: Used in hydrogels, drug delivery systems, and medical devices.
  • Others: Includes applications in textiles, composites, and electronics.

By End-User Industry:

  • Construction
  • Automotive
  • Industrial Manufacturing
  • Healthcare
  • Electronics

Among these, the construction industry represents the largest consumer of cross-linkers in Russia, driven by the need for durable coatings and adhesives. The automotive sector is another significant segment, leveraging cross-linkers to produce lightweight and high-strength materials.
